Tips for Finding STEM OPT Authorization as an Actuarial Analyst

Confirm your CIP code qualifies first

Actuarial science (CIP 27.0301) and applied mathematics (CIP 27.0301) qualify for STEM OPT, but statistics and financial mathematics codes vary. Ask your DSO to confirm your degree's CIP code before accepting any offer.

Verify E-Verify enrollment before signing

STEM OPT requires your employer to be enrolled in E-Verify, not just eligible to enroll. Ask the hiring manager or HR to confirm active enrollment status before you accept an offer, since not all actuarial employers have signed up.

Build your exam progress into your resume

Actuarial employers prioritize candidates who have passed at least one Society of Actuaries or Casualty Actuarial Society exam. List your passed exams and exam dates clearly so hiring managers can immediately gauge where you are in the credentialing path.

Draft your I-983 training plan around actuarial competencies

Your I-983 must connect your job duties to your STEM degree. For actuarial roles, map tasks like loss reserving, pricing models, and experience studies directly to the quantitative coursework in your transcript when completing the plan with your employer.

Use cap-gap protection to bridge to H-1B if needed

If your employer files an H-1B visa petition before April 1 and you're selected in the lottery, cap-gap automatically extends your OPT authorization through September 30. Confirm the timeline with USCIS so you don't interrupt employment during the gap period.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does my STEM degree qualify me for the 24-month STEM OPT extension as an Actuarial Analyst?

Your degree qualifies if it appears on the STEM Designated Degree Program List and carries an eligible CIP code. Actuarial science, mathematics, and statistics degrees typically qualify, but financial economics or business degrees may not. Your DSO confirms eligibility by checking your degree's CIP code against the official list before filing your extension application with USCIS.

Is my Actuarial Analyst employer required to be enrolled in E-Verify?

Yes. E-Verify enrollment is a legal requirement for any employer hiring a STEM OPT student, not a preference. Your employer must be actively enrolled in E-Verify before your extension begins. If the employer hasn't enrolled, your STEM OPT extension won't be valid for that position, even if USCIS has already approved the extension on your EAD.

What goes into the I-983 training plan for an Actuarial Analyst role?

The I-983 must describe how your day-to-day actuarial duties relate to your STEM degree. You and your employer complete it together, listing specific tasks such as building pricing models, running reserve analyses, or working with loss triangles, and connecting each to quantitative skills from your degree program. Your DSO must sign off before the extension is approved.

What happens to my STEM OPT authorization if my employer files an H-1B petition during my extension?

If your employer submits a timely H-1B cap-subject petition before April 1 of your final STEM OPT year and you're selected in the lottery, cap-gap protection extends your work authorization through September 30. Your EAD remains valid during this bridge period. USCIS guidance confirms the cap-gap rule applies to STEM OPT holders in the same way it applies to initial OPT holders.
